About the role

The Training Supervisor is accountable for planning, delivering, evaluating, and administering training programs. This includes new employee orientation, on-the-job training, skill development, compliance, safety, regulatory, corporate, and other training as needed. They also enhance current training programs to align with plant goals for safety, quality, and production.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inates with management team to identify training needs and activities.
  • Ensures job training qualification and certification processes are followed.
  • Tracks training events, maintains accurate training records, and provides reports on training progress and completion to leadership.
  • Ensures required training documentation is maintained.
  • May provide instruction or support at other facilities as requested.
  • Communicates effectively with all levels across the plant.
  • Manages employee new hire progress and engagement.
  • Participates in job interviews.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

Qualifications, Skills And Knowledge

  • Bachelor of Science Degree in Education, Human Resources, or Organizational Development or equivalent experience preferred.
  • 2 - 5 years previous work experience in a manufacturing environment or corrugated industry preferred.
  • Demonstrated strong communication skills in oral and written communications and developing presentations.
  • Experience delivering training sessions preferred.
  • Proficient in computer applications (including MS Office – Word, Excel, Power Point, etc.).
  • Understanding of meeting facilitation principles, adult learning theory, and techniques and best practices for creating / delivering effective training.
  • Understanding of manufacturing operations, processes, job positions/structure preferred.
  • Experience compiling and publishing training metrics.
  • Demonstrated attention to detail, organization, and time-management skills.
